AceShowbiz - Shia LaBeouf expresses his dislike towards U.S. president Donald Trump in an extraordinary way. On Trump's inauguration day, LaBeouf started a live-stream protest titled "HE WILL NOT DIVIDE US". The official website of the protest says that it will run for four years or as long as the duration of Trump's presidency.

For the project, LaBeouf along with his art collaborators Luke Turner and Nastja Sade Ronkko planted a camera outside Museum of Moving Image in New York City. This project invites people to stand in front of the camera to chant a phrase "he will not divide us" and the footage will be broadcast for 24 hours straight on its website.

LaBeouf chose this phrase to show "the resistance or insistence, opposition or optimism, guided by the spirit of each individual participant and the community." The participants can say the phrase as many time as they want since the idea of the phrase is to become a "mantra" to start a movement.

The first participant of LaBeouf's project was Will Smith's oldest child, Jaden Smith. The actor/rapper stood in front of the camera and showed ambiguous expression while repeating the mantra over and over. "He will not divide us. He," Smith said before pausing. "Will not divide us," he continued and then added a stuttering version, "He. Will. Not. Divide. Us."

LaBeouf also took to Twitter to announce his project. He posted a picture of Smith staring at the wall with the mantra "he will not divide us" written on it. He tweeted, "HEWILLNOTDIVIDE.US NOW LIVE Museum of the Moving Image, New York."

LaBeouf has been known for his live-stream project. Previously, the actor staged the #ALLMYMOVIES project which was a live-stream showing the actor watching all the films he starred in.
